We're already starting to see threads pop up asking about exploit, homebrew, flashcart and piracy possibilities on the Switch. Put simply:
  • We have no idea about the hardware or software on the Switch
  • Even if we did know, it took several years to break the Wii U and 3DS, so it's likely that we won't know about any exploits for the Switch for a similar timescale
There is absolutely no point posting threads asking what the possibilities will be for homebrew or piracy on the Switch. Any discussion of this is purely speculative and completely unhelpful in any endeavours to actually hack the console.

Please just be patient. It will happen when it happens.
